How they compare
Cambodia currently reports 1,177 Square kilometres against 1,077 Square kilometres in Bangladesh, a difference of 100 Square kilometres.
That makes Cambodia's figure about 1.1 times Bangladesh's.
The two have swapped places 1 time across 6 shared years of data; in 2000 it was Bangladesh ahead.
Bangladesh ranks 98th and Cambodia ranks 97th of 207 countries.
Cambodia has averaged higher in every one of the 3 decades both report.

About this data
The land cover dataset provides a global assessment of land cover and land cover change to monitor pressures on ecosystems and biodiversity. By using geospatial data with high spatio-temporal resolution, it develops a set of internationally comparable indicators with a long time series and a five-year interval from 2000 to 2022 for the Climate Change Initiative Land Cover dataset, and from 1975 to 2030 for the Global Human Settlement Layer dataset. Please see the working paper for a more complete description of the methods. The dataset has a global coverage on the national level, while on the sub-national TL2 level (i.e. large subnational regions) results are reported for all OECD countries as well as for Argentina, Brazil, China, India, Indonesia and South Africa. The following country aggregates are included: Euro area, European Union, Advanced economies, Emerging market economies, G7, G20, OECD, OECD Europe, OECD Asia Oceania, OECD Americas, the LAC region and the World.
